Technical Parameters & Selection Guide

SpecificationValueEngineering Notes
Model DesignationDSRF185Standard equipment frame for 800xA DCS
Part Number3BSE004382R1ABB factory identification code
System Compatibility800xA DCS, Advant OCSBackward compatible with legacy systems
Module CapacityUp to 8 modulesConfiguration-dependent, includes spacing
Rack Standard19-inch (482.6 mm)Universal cabinet integration
Frame Weight7.93 kgUnloaded weight, modules sold separately
Operating Temperature0°C to +55°CAmbient air temperature range
Storage Temperature-25°C to +70°CNon-condensing conditions
Material ConstructionIndustrial steelCorrosion-resistant coating applied
Country of OriginSwedenABB manufacturing facility

Selection Criteria: Choose the DSRF185 when your project requires standardized mounting infrastructure for ABB 800xA or Advant OCS systems. This frame is optimal for installations with 3-8 control modules per cabinet location. For larger configurations exceeding 8 modules, consider multiple frames with coordinated power distribution. Verify cabinet depth accommodates frame dimensions plus required cable management clearances (minimum 600mm recommended).

Q: Does the frame require special grounding procedures for EMC compliance?
A: The DSRF185 includes integrated grounding points that should be connected to your cabinet's central grounding bar using minimum 6 AWG (4mm²) copper conductors. Follow ABB's grounding guidelines document 3BSE030230 to achieve optimal EMC performance and meet IEC 61000-6-2 industrial immunity standards.

Q: How do I calculate the total power requirements for a fully populated frame?
A: Each module's power consumption is specified in its datasheet (typically 5-25W per module). Sum individual module power draws and add 20% safety margin for inrush current and future expansion. Most DSRF185 installations require 100-200W total power supply capacity when fully populated with standard I/O and communication modules.
